Can I move out of my parents' house at 18 while in school?

Full question:

I want to move out of my parents house when i'm 18, but i'll still be in school. Is it legal for me to do that?

  • Category: Minors
  • Subcategory: Liability of Parent
  • Date:
  • State: Louisiana

Answer:

In Louisiana, a person is considered an adult at age 18. This means you can choose where to live, including moving out of your parents' house, unless there is a specific legal order preventing you from doing so.

FAQs

Yes, in Louisiana, you can legally move out of your parents' house at 18, even if you are still in high school. Once you reach 18, you are considered an adult and have the right to choose your living situation. However, it's important to consider your financial stability and living arrangements before making this decision.
